My Approach to Therapy

Are you feeling stuck or out of balance in your life? I believe I can help shift you to a place of increased clarity, focus and positive movement in your life. I assist clients to find solutions to present day challenges as well as address any underlying or unresolved matters that are keeping them in undesirable and unhealthy patterns.

I bring over 20 years of professional experience to the therapy process. I help adults, families, children and adolescents with a variety of challenges including depression, anxiety, grief/loss, and relationship and family stress. 

I incorporate EFT (Emotional Freedom Technique; also known as"Tapping") and eye movement therapy into sessions. These powerful, evidence based Energy Psychology techniques help to more quickly and fully identify, process and release past experiences, negative beliefs and patterns and that keep us stuck. These techniques go beyond traditional talk therapy, allowing emotionally charged material to be processed in a gentle way, with deep and lasting results. Please view my video below to learn more about EFT. I also used the framework of Polyvagal theory to build flexibility and resilience in our nervous system responses to life challenges.

It is my honor to join with clients in their life journey to increase overall life satisfaction and meaning. I welcome the opportunity to work with you.
